Australian TV journalist who met with Rita Wilson has virus

CANBERRA – An Australian television journalist said Monday he has the new coronavirus and assumes he contracted it while meeting with actress-singer Rita Wilson in Sydney. Wilson and her husband Tom Hanks have been isolated in an Australian hospital since they were both diagnosed with COVID-19 on March 12. Hanks had been working on a film in Australia and Wilson had concert performances in the country before they were diagnosed. Nine Network entertainment editor Richard Wilkins said he was tested because he met Wilson at the Sydney Opera House on March 7 and again at Nine’s Sydney studio on March 9. Wilkins’ son Christian Wilkins was tested because he spent the night of March 10 in his father’s Sydney home.

Tom Hanks, Rita Wilson test positive for coronavirus

(L-R) Rita Wilson and Tom Hanks attend the 77th Annual Golden Globe Awards at The Beverly Hilton Hotel on January 05, 2020 in Beverly Hills, California. Academy Award-winning actor Tom Hanks and his wife Rita Wilson have tested positive for the coronavirus, Hanks revealed Wednesday. Hanks and Wilson are in Australia for the pre-production of Baz Luhrmann's currently untitled Elvis Presley film from Warner Bros. Hanks is set to play Presley's longtime manager Colonel Tom Parker. To play things right, as is needed in the world right now, we were tested for the Coronavirus, and were found to be positive." While the untitled Elvis film isn't due into theaters until October 2021, Hanks has three movies slated for release in 2020.

Elvis Presley Film Casts 'The Society' Star Olivia DeJonge as Priscilla Presley

Olivia DeJonge has been cast to portray Priscilla Presley in the upcoming Elvis Presley biopic from Baz Luhrmann. Austin Butler has already been cast as Elvis and Tom Hanks will be playing Elvis' manager, Colonel Tom Parker. The film will explore Elvis' iconic career, focusing on the relationship between Elvis and Parker. Luhrmann said of the casting in a statement, Olivia is capable of manifesting the complex depth and presence that has made Priscilla Presley an icon in her own right.
